What Is Contact Dermatitis in Cats?
Contact dermatitis in cats is an inflammatory skin reaction that happens when the skin directly touches an irritating or allergy-causing substance [1, 2]. Although it can look alarming, the good news is that identifying and removing the trigger typically leads to a full recovery.
The condition is relatively uncommon in cats compared with humans because their dense hair coat acts as a natural protective barrier [1, 3]. When it does occur, lesions tend to appear on the sparsely haired regions where the skin is more exposed, such as the belly, groin, and armpits. The reaction can come on suddenly (acute) after a single exposure or develop gradually into a long-term (chronic) problem with repeated or ongoing contact [3].
There are two main forms, irritant and allergic, and understanding which type your cat has is the first step toward effective treatment.
Signs and Symptoms of Contact Dermatitis in Cats
The hallmark of contact dermatitis is skin inflammation that follows the pattern of direct contact with a substance. Owners typically notice redness, itchiness, or sores on areas where the hair is thin: the underside of the belly, the armpits (axillae), the groin, the scrotum, the spaces between the toes, and occasionally the inner ear flaps, especially after topical medications [3].
The allergic form (allergic contact dermatitis, or ACD) usually causes intense itching (pruritus), red skin (erythema), and small raised bumps called papules [1, 3]. The itch may not be as dramatic as the lesions look, but it is persistent. When ACD goes on for weeks or months, the skin can become thickened and leathery (a change called lichenification), darkened (hyperpigmentation), and crusted, with scratch marks on top [1, 3]. Importantly, ACD lesions often spread slightly beyond the exact spot that touched the substance because the immune reaction extends into the surrounding skin [3].
Irritant contact dermatitis (ICD) feels different. Instead of itching, your cat is more likely to show signs of pain. You may see blisters (vesicles), raw spots (erosions), or open sores (ulcerations), and these lesions tend to be sharply confined to the precise area of contact [1, 3].
Both forms can quickly develop secondary infections. When scratching or chewing breaks the skin barrier, bacteria and yeast can invade, leading to pustules, crusts, or a greasy, smelly coat [1]. Speed of onset is another useful clue: allergic reactions appear within hours to a few days after re-exposure in a sensitized cat, while irritant reactions occur immediately on first contact [1].
Common Causes and Risk Factors for Contact Dermatitis in Cats
The biggest step in managing contact dermatitis is identifying what your cat is actually touching. Common culprits include houseplants (especially wandering Jew/Tradescantia from the Commelinaceae family), topical medications, shampoos, flea dips, household cleaners, plastic and rubber items, and even cement dust [1, 2, 3]. Many of these substances can both irritate and sensitize the skin, so the same product can act as an irritant the first time and an allergen later on [3].
One of the trickiest features of allergic contact dermatitis is delayed onset. A cat may use a shampoo or a spot-on product for months or even years with no problem, then suddenly react because the immune system has slowly become primed against it. Sensitization typically takes 6 to 24 months, which is why "new" is not always the trigger, often it is something tried and true [1].
What makes a cat more vulnerable? Moisture is a major factor. Damp skin weakens the natural barrier and lets substances penetrate more deeply [3]. Cats' fastidious grooming habits normally help by physically removing irritants before they reach the skin, which is partly why the disease is uncommon [2]. No specific breed, sex, or age predisposition has been documented, any cat can develop it if the exposure is right. Contact dermatitis predominantly affects sparsely haired or hairless skin areas such as the ventral abdomen (belly), scrotum, axilla, groin, perineum, and brisket area. Finally, the longer or more often a cat contacts even a mild substance, the higher the risk that a clinical reaction will develop.
Types of Contact Dermatitis in Cats
Contact dermatitis comes in two distinct forms, and recognizing the difference shapes how your vet approaches the case. The first is irritant contact dermatitis (ICD), which is a non-immunologic reaction caused by direct chemical or physical damage to skin cells called keratinocytes [1, 2]. It is dose-dependent and shows up the first time the cat meets the offending substance, no prior sensitization required [1].
The second form is allergic contact dermatitis (ACD), a type IV (delayed) hypersensitivity reaction. Tiny molecules called haptens penetrate the skin, bind to proteins, and trigger T-cell sensitization [1]. This process unfolds in two phases:
- Sensitization phase: During initial exposures, the immune system quietly becomes primed. There are usually no clinical signs. This phase takes at least six months and often more than two years [1].
- Elicitation phase: Upon re-exposure, primed T cells mount a local inflammatory response within 24 to 72 hours. The flare-up can be dramatic [1].
Key clinical distinctions to remember: ICD lesions are painful and stay neatly confined to the contact area, while ACD lesions are itchy and can spread beyond the original spot [1, 3]. In real-world cases, however, the two often overlap, because many contact irritants are also haptens, a single substance can drive both mechanisms at once [3].
How Vets Diagnose Contact Dermatitis in Cats
Because contact dermatitis is uncommon, your vet will usually start by ruling out more likely culprits. These include flea allergy dermatitis (FAD), food allergy, atopic dermatitis (environmental allergy), sarcoptic and demodectic mange, ringworm (dermatophytosis), and bacterial skin infection [2, 1, 3].
A detailed history is the single most important tool. Your vet will ask you to list every substance your cat encounters, medications, shampoos, dips, cleaning products, plants, bedding materials, plastic bowls, and note whether flare-ups follow a seasonal or situational pattern [1, 3]. On physical examination, the vet pays special attention to whether the lesions sit on thinly haired skin and what they look like (papules versus blisters, for instance) [3]. Initial tests typically include skin scrapings to look for mites, a fungal culture for ringworm, and cytology (microscopic examination of cells from the skin surface) to spot secondary bacterial or yeast infections [1].
The most practical diagnostic tool is the avoidance trial. Your cat is bathed to remove any residue and then confined to a clean, controlled area. If the skin improves within 1β3 weeks and fully resolves within 7β10 days, and signs return when the cat is re-exposed to the suspected substance, contact dermatitis becomes the working diagnosis [1, 3]. Patch testing, in which diluted suspected allergens are applied under a bandage for 48 hours and the skin is then examined for a reaction, is considered the gold standard for ACD. However, it is rarely performed in cats because keeping a bandage on the chest is difficult and no standardized feline allergen panels exist [1, 3]. Skin biopsy is of limited use. Unless the sample is taken within 12 hours of acute exposure, when it may show a spongiotic (inflamed, fluid-filled) pattern, it usually reveals only nonspecific chronic inflammation [3].
What this means for your cat: In practice, your vet is most likely to recommend an avoidance trial rather than biopsies or patch testing. Be prepared to commit 1β3 weeks to confinement and a strict environmental cleanup. Serum allergy tests that measure allergen-specific IgE (an allergy antibody) do not reliably distinguish normal from atopic cats and have no validated role in diagnosing contact dermatitis. Intradermal allergy testing is intended for atopic dermatitis, not contact allergy. Final diagnosis relies on a detailed history, resolution of signs with avoidance, and recurrence upon re-exposure. , [1]
Treatment Options for Contact Dermatitis in Cats
The cornerstone of treatment is removing the offending substance from your cat's environment. Until the trigger is identified and eliminated, medications will only provide temporary relief [2, 1]. Bathing your cat with lukewarm water or a gentle hypoallergenic shampoo helps wash away residual allergen or irritant clinging to the coat and offers immediate relief [1, 3].
For acute flare-ups, a short, tapering course of oral prednisolone (a corticosteroid) prescribed by your veterinarian is highly effective at calming inflammation and itching. Topical corticosteroid sprays, creams, or shampoos can also be used on localized lesions [1]. Caution is warranted with corticosteroids: repeated or long-term use without allergen avoidance may lead to tachyphylaxis (reduced efficacy over time) and systemic side effects such as increased thirst (polydipsia), increased urination (polyuria), and increased appetite [1].
If a secondary bacterial or yeast infection has taken hold, your cat will need an appropriate course of systemic treatment, often an antibiotic like cephalexin for bacteria or an antifungal for yeast, usually lasting several weeks [1]. A few options are not worth relying on. Antihistamines and essential fatty acid (EFA) supplements have not shown benefit for contact dermatitis and are not recommended [1]. Hyposensitization ("allergy shots") is also ineffective, because it works for atopic dermatitis, not contact allergy [1].
For refractory cases, where the trigger cannot be identified or avoided, off-label use of topical tacrolimus, oral cyclosporine, or oclacitinib may be considered. Evidence is limited and extrapolated from feline hypersensitivity dermatitis: oral cyclosporine tapering achieved improvement in over 70% of cats with hypersensitivity dermatitis, and a small study reported that oclacitinib showed short-term efficacy comparable to methylprednisolone. Your veterinarian can discuss whether these options make sense for your cat. ,
Successful long-term control depends on both medical treatment and your commitment to maintaining an allergen-free environment. [2]
Preventing Contact Dermatitis in Cats
The single best preventive measure is to identify and permanently avoid the trigger substance. [2] Once you know what your cat reacted to, removing it from the home is the most effective action you can take.
Practical steps include:
- Choose gentle products. Use fragrance-free, mild, pet-specific grooming products and household cleaners whenever possible.
- Watch the houseplants. Keep cats away from plants of the Commelinaceae family (such as wandering Jew/Tradescantia) and other known dermatitis-causing plants [1].
- Bathe promptly after suspicious contact. If your cat walks through or lies on a freshly cleaned floor, treated garden, or other suspect surface, a quick bath can wash off the substance before significant absorption [1].
- Keep the skin dry. Moisture weakens the barrier and makes reactions more likely, so dry your cat thoroughly after bathing or any exposure to rain [3].
- Don't rely on supplements. No dietary supplement or fatty acid has been proven to prevent contact dermatitis [1].
- Think about multi-pet households. If one cat is showing signs, the shared environment may be the issue, and changes should apply to all pets [2].
Complications of Untreated Contact Dermatitis in Cats
Leaving contact dermatitis unmanaged can lead to permanent skin changes and painful secondary infections. Chronic inflammation causes the skin to thicken into a leathery texture (lichenification) and become hyperpigmented, and these changes can persist even after the original trigger is removed [3].
Persistent scratching and chewing break down the epidermal barrier (the skin's outermost protective layer), inviting bacterial and yeast (often Malassezia) infections. These can range from superficial pyoderma (pustules and crusts) to deeper skin infections such as cellulitis, which may require extended antibiotic courses [1, 2]. Severe irritant dermatitis or ulceration is painful and can affect your cat's quality of life. Affected cats may hide, eat less, or become uncharacteristically aggressive.
If the allergen remains in the environment, a vicious cycle can take hold: inflammation leads to infection, infection increases itch, more scratching causes more trauma, and the condition becomes chronic and harder to control [2]. In areas subjected to repeated trauma, scarring and permanent hair loss may also occur. In rare cases, especially in immunocompromised cats, deep infection can become systemic (spread throughout the body), becoming a medical emergency.
Prognosis: Will My Cat's Contact Dermatitis Go Away?
Contact dermatitis is highly manageable, but the underlying allergic tendency is lifelong. True "cure", eliminating the immune system's sensitization, is not possible; once a cat is allergic to a substance, that tendency persists for life [1, 2].
That said, the prognosis for an excellent quality of life is very good when the trigger is found and avoided. For these cats, complete clinical remission is expected and they live comfortably without medication [2]. Irritant contact dermatitis can resolve fully once the irritant is removed, with no lasting hypersensitivity [1].
If ongoing exposure continues, recurrence is inevitable. Long-term control with corticosteroids may be required, and over time the same dose may become less effective, a phenomenon called tachyphylaxis [1]. When the offending allergen cannot be identified and avoided, lifelong intermittent therapy may help reduce clinical signs but often does not lead to complete resolution; continual exposure can also limit the response to treatments such as glucocorticoids.
Owner commitment to strict environmental control and allergen avoidance is the single biggest predictor of treatment success.
Similar Conditions That Can Look Like Contact Dermatitis in Cats
Because many skin diseases look alike, accurate diagnosis is essential. Several common feline skin conditions can mimic contact dermatitis:
- Flea allergy dermatitis (FAD): the most common cause of itchy skin in cats. Distribution is often over the back and tail base, and finding fleas or flea dirt on the cat confirms the diagnosis. A strict flea control trial often resolves the signs [2, 3].
- Food allergy: causes non-seasonal itching, often affecting the head, neck, and sometimes the whole body. It is diagnosed with a strict elimination diet trial [2, 3].
- Atopic dermatitis (environmental allergy): typically involves the face, ears, and paws, sometimes the ventral abdomen, and is often seasonal. It may be supported by intradermal skin testing or serum IgE testing [3].
- Sarcoptic mange (scabies): causes severe itching with crusty lesions on the ear margins, elbows, and hocks. Skin scrapings are diagnostic, although mites can be elusive [1, 3].
- Ringworm (dermatophytosis): presents as circular patches of hair loss with scaling and crusting; diagnosed by Wood's lamp examination, fungal culture, or PCR testing [1].
- Superficial bacterial pyoderma: produces pustules, crusts, and epidermal collarettes (circular areas of peeling skin). It is usually secondary to an underlying itchy condition and resolves with antibiotics once the primary cause is addressed [3].
- Adverse cutaneous drug reactions: can mimic contact dermatitis but are often more widespread and linked to oral or injectable medications rather than topical contact [3].
- Photosensitization: inflammation only on white-haired, sun-exposed skin, such as ear tips and eyelids, related to UV exposure [3].
A key distinguishing feature of contact dermatitis is its strict association with contact sites and improvement upon removal of the suspected substance; other conditions will not respond solely to environmental change [1, 3].
What We Still Don't Know: Gaps and Current Research
Contact dermatitis is likely underdiagnosed in cats, partly because it overlaps with more common allergies and partly because definitive tests are hard to perform. [3] A standard veterinary patch test for allergic contact dermatitis is not currently available; human patch test methods have been used in dogs, but their sensitivity and specificity have not been evaluated in animals [3].
The effectiveness of immunomodulatory agents such as cyclosporine, tacrolimus, and oclacitinib for feline contact dermatitis remains anecdotal, as no high-quality clinical trials have specifically evaluated them for this condition. However, cyclosporine and oclacitinib have shown efficacy in cats with hypersensitivity dermatitis. , The role of skin barrier dysfunction in feline allergic contact dermatitis, and the potential benefit of lipid barrier repair products, remain unexplored, although moisture-induced barrier impairment is a recognized predisposing factor [3].
Genetic risk factors or breed predispositions for contact dermatitis in cats have never been systematically studied. Better diagnostic biomarkers and reliable histopathological criteria (clear patterns under the microscope) are needed to differentiate allergic from irritant contact dermatitis; skin biopsy currently shows nonspecific changes and is only useful if performed within 12 hours of exposure [3]. Long-term management outcomes, including quality-of-life assessments comparing allergen avoidance with immunomodulatory therapy, are lacking. For oclacitinib, only short-term benefits have been observed, and long-term outcomes remain unknown. Future research directions include the development of feline-specific patch test allergens, randomized controlled trials (the gold-standard study design) of novel therapies, and genetic studies to identify at-risk cats.

What does feline dermatitis look like?
Feline dermatitis typically appears as red, itchy, or inflamed skin, often on the belly, groin, armpits, or paws where hair is thin. You may see small bumps, crusts, hair loss, scabs, or open sores. In irritant cases, blisters or ulcers develop. Cats often lick, scratch, or over-groom the area. With chronic cases, the skin may become thickened, darkened, or greasy.
Will cat dermatitis go away on its own?
It depends on the cause. Irritant contact dermatitis often resolves quickly once the offending substance is removed. Allergic contact dermatitis usually persists and tends to flare every time the cat touches the trigger. Without identifying and avoiding the underlying cause, most cases will not resolve on their own and may worsen over time, leading to secondary infections or chronic skin changes.
Can cat litter cause contact dermatitis?
Yes, cat litter can cause contact dermatitis in sensitive cats, especially litter with added fragrances, deodorizers, or dyes. Clay and silica dust can also irritate skin on the belly, paws, or perineum when a cat digs and grooms. Switching to an unscented, dust-free, natural litter and keeping the box clean often helps. Patchy irritation on the paws or lower body is a clue.
How do indoor cats get dermatitis?
Even indoor-only cats encounter plenty of potential triggers: scented cat litter, household cleaners, laundry detergents on bedding, plastic food bowls, air fresheners, candles, essential oil diffusers, certain houseplants like wandering Jew, shampoos, and topical flea medications. New furniture, carpets, or renovations introduce irritants, too. Moisture from damp bedding or humid environments weakens the skin barrier and increases risk.
Can a dirty litter box cause skin problems in cats?
Yes. A dirty litter box can contribute to skin problems in several ways. Ammonia buildup from urine and fecal residue irritates the skin of the paws, perineum, and belly. Moisture from soiled litter softens the skin barrier. Bacteria and yeast that thrive in dirty litter can cause secondary skin infections, especially if the cat is already scratching. Keeping the box clean reduces these risks significantly.
How to treat contact dermatitis on cats?
Treatment starts with identifying and removing the trigger substance. A bath with lukewarm water or a gentle hypoallergenic shampoo helps wash off residue. Your vet may prescribe a short course of corticosteroids to calm inflammation and itching, plus antibiotics or antifungals for any secondary infection. Antihistamines and "allergy shots" do not help contact dermatitis. Strict environmental control is essential for long-term success.
How to get rid of cat dermatitis naturally?
While gentle supportive care at home helps, true contact dermatitis usually requires veterinary diagnosis to identify the trigger. Once identified, you can remove the offending substance naturally by switching to fragrance-free, pet-safe cleaners and unscented grooming products. Bathing with plain lukewarm water removes residue. Omega-3 supplements may support skin health but do not treat active dermatitis. Avoid herbal or essential-oil remedies unless approved by your vet, as many are toxic to cats.
Is Zyrtec or Benadryl better for cats?
Neither Zyrtec (cetirizine) nor Benadryl (diphenhydramine) reliably treats contact dermatitis in cats, and evidence for their use in any feline allergic skin disease is weak. Both can also cause side effects such as sedation or, less commonly, hyperexcitability. Never give any human antihistamine to your cat without veterinary guidance, some formulations contain ingredients that are toxic to cats.
